IMO Insurance: A Deep Dive

Introduction: IMO insurance, distributed by Independent Marketing Organizations, offers a diverse range of insurance policies across various sectors. Understanding the nuances of this distribution method is key to leveraging its benefits. The system relies heavily on independent agents who represent multiple insurance providers, allowing consumers access to a wider selection of plans.

Key Aspects:

  • Independent Agents: These agents are not tied to a single insurance company, fostering competition and potentially better deals for consumers. They act as intermediaries, providing guidance and comparing plans from various providers.
  • Policy Variety: IMO networks typically offer a broad range of insurance options, including life insurance, health insurance, auto insurance, and more. This breadth allows consumers to tailor coverage to their specific circumstances.
  • Affordability: The competitive environment fostered by IMOs can lead to more competitive pricing and potentially more affordable premiums. However, this is not always guaranteed and must be examined on a case-by-case basis.
  • Transparency: While IMOs aim for transparency, it's crucial to carefully review policy documents and understand all terms and conditions before committing.

Discussion: The IMO model offers advantages and potential challenges. The selection of plans is a significant advantage, allowing consumers to customize their coverage based on their needs and budget. However, navigating the complexity of multiple provider options requires careful consideration and potentially a higher level of consumer engagement than traditional insurance methods. The role of the independent agent becomes paramount in guiding consumers through this process. Their expertise in comparing plans and explaining policy details is vital.

The Role of Independent Agents in IMO Insurance

Introduction: Independent agents are the linchpin of the IMO insurance model. Their expertise and guidance are crucial for consumers navigating the complex insurance landscape.

Further Analysis: These agents act as advisors, providing personalized recommendations based on individual needs and preferences. They compare policies from different insurance providers, offering a comprehensive view of the market and helping clients make informed decisions. Their commission structure is typically based on sales, incentivizing them to provide sound advice and find suitable policies for their clients. However, it's important for consumers to remember that the agent’s primary goal is to sell a policy, so independent verification of the policy’s details is still crucial.

Closing: Independent agents play a crucial role in making the IMO insurance model efficient. However, responsible consumers should maintain an active role in evaluating plans and understanding the details of their policies.

FAQ: Addressing Common Concerns about IMO Insurance

Introduction: This section clarifies common questions and misconceptions surrounding IMO insurance.

Questions:

  • Q: What is an IMO, and how does it differ from a traditional insurance company? A: An IMO is an Independent Marketing Organization, a network of independent agents representing multiple insurance providers. Unlike traditional companies, IMOs do not underwrite policies; they connect clients with suitable insurers.
  • Q: Are IMO insurance policies reliable? A: The reliability depends on the underlying insurance company, not the IMO itself. Choose reputable insurers with strong financial ratings.
  • Q: How can I choose the right IMO agent? A: Look for agents with experience, positive reviews, and a commitment to transparency.
  • Q: What is the claims process with IMO insurance? A: The claims process varies depending on the insurer. The IMO agent may assist in guiding you through the process.
  • Q: Are IMO insurance policies more expensive? A: The cost depends on many factors. IMOs can offer competitive pricing, but it is essential to compare various options.
  • Q: Can I switch insurance providers within an IMO network? A: This is generally possible, depending on the specific policies and terms.
